<a HREF="http://abclocal.go.com/ktrk/news/032904_local_calvin.html">According to Channel 13,</a> The alleged indecency occurred in Harris County over a period of several years, Rosenthal said. The charges involved five girls under 17 and the alleged conduct occurred between May 1988 and April 1991, according to the Harris County district clerk's office. According to an affidavit by Drew Carter of the Texas Rangers, the five daughters said Murphy either fondled them, performed oral sex or both. -------- I really hope none of these things are true as well.
